New design

▁ oct 18 2004

Recently I launched a new design on printf.dk. It featured optimus prime, so I thought it was cool. Although, I got tired of it pretty fast. I sat down and planned a new design, and you’re looking at it right now. I gathered inspiration around, and this is the outcome. I think it’s pretty good. My buddy Mikkel over at casius.dk was so friendly to let me in on some free hosting at one of his servers. This is a great improvement to the previous connection this website was hosted on, namely a 2mbit DSL. The newly found connection features a 100mbit direct link to the outside world. :-)

I’ve decided to move away from PHP; ever since I got hired at Opera Software, I’ve been ‘forced’ to do modperl and since doing websites in modperl directly isn’t exactly the best philosophy, I’ve been using raw XML transformed by XSLT. This experience has really opened my eyes to how powerful XML can be in practice, thus I have decided to do this webpage in XML and XSLT. What worries me though, is that XSLT has been around for quite some time, and I haven’t picked up on it. Perhaps my entusiasm for new technologies isn’t what it used to be. That being said, I definitly have picked up on a lot of new technologies after starting here. One of the things I have yet to look into, that I will be forced to use in a near future, is SVG. Also, this has been around for a while now; I’m forcing myself into reading up on it. So, this is gonna be the current design of my site for now. I’ve planned to expand it further later on, with articles, extending the WiKi and so forth. My spare time at the moment is very limited, since I am working on a rather large project at work. This isn’t a bad thing though; I have great personal interest in the project, so even when I’m not actually at work, I still work on the project. This is a thing I have been missing in previous jobs.
